Heritage Creek Ranch is located near Pauls Valley in Garvin County, Oklahoma. This 277 acre ranch offers a rare combination of productive pasture, established pecan production, strong soils, water, beautiful homesites, and exceptional convenience. Situated just minutes from Pauls Valley and Interstate 35, the ranch is approximately 60 miles south of Oklahoma City and about 145 miles north of the DFW Metroplex, making it easily accessible for buyers traveling from either direction.
The owners come from a family of conservationists with a deep understanding of the soils, grasses, and water resources that make a ranch productive in the area. They used that knowledge to hand-select ranches with some of the strongest soil profiles in the county for grazing and long-term agricultural pursuits. This ranch is part of that legacy - land chosen by those who knew what good ground looked like, not just from the road, but from the soil up.
The soil profile of the ranch reinforces that story. The property is made up largely of productive loam and silt loam soils with approximately 70% of the ranch consisting of Class 2 and Class 3 soils, providing a strong foundation for forage, grazing, and pecan production. That quality land base is one of the reasons this ranch has supported a successful cattle operation for so many years.
The pastures are well established, with bermuda grass in the open ground and fescue growing throughout the pecan groves. With approximately 1,200 pecan trees, the ranch also offers an agricultural component that goes beyond typical pastureland. For a buyer looking at the property from an income-producing or investment standpoint, the pecan trees may represent a valuable depreciable asset.
Water is another key strength of the property. The ranch features six ponds and is flanked by an unnamed creek, providing livestock water, wildlife habitat, and recreation. The creek corridor, ponds, pecan groves, and open pasture create a balanced landscape that is both functional and beautiful.

Opportunities to own a highly productive, well-managed cattle ranch of this caliber are becoming increasingly difficult to find in Oklahoma! Spanning 464 +/- acres in Garvin County, the Sandy Creek Ranch has been carefully developed for efficient livestock production while still offering the recreational appeal that many landowners desire. Sandy Creek winds through the property and is complemented by 11 ponds that provide abundant water sources for livestock and wildlife. The land features an exceptional blend of native grasses, lush Bermuda and fescue, creating a hard-to-find extended grazing season that helps reduce winter feeding costs. The ranch currently supports approximately 85 +/- cows and historically requires only a limited amount of supplemental hay, typically between January 20th and March 20th. Extensive cross fencing allows for effective pasture management and rotational grazing, while multiple access points make working cattle and navigating the property simple and convenient.
